#ba4c34 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ba4c34 is composed of 72.9% red, 29.8%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.1% magenta, 72%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 10.7 degrees, a saturation of 56.3% and a lightness of 46.7%. #ba4c34 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9868 with #750000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#ba4c34
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#fbf3f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ba4c34
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7574 is the less saturated color, while #e82f06 is the most saturated one.
